Although at first glance it might seem like just another entry in the expanded Star Wars universe, Tales of the Underworld turns out to be quite an interesting offering. It dives into the shadows of the galaxy and brings two classic Clone Wars villains back into the spotlight, giving them some well-deserved depth. It doesn’t break new ground, but it does offer narrative fragments that enrich the larger **** Bane’s arc, in particular, stands out. You can tell there’s an effort to explore the motivations and moral codes behind his ruthless image. The animation is solid, with the same recognizable style seen in The Bad Batch or Tales of the Jedi, but with a slightly darker, almost noir tone.Some of the stories do feel too short or predictable. Certain decisions could’ve used more development, and some scenes needed more room to breathe. Still, the overall feeling is of something purposeful, respectful of the lore, and filled with moments where the galaxy’s underbelly becomes the perfect excuse to explore moral ambiguity.This isn't a series for everyone. It lacks the emotional core of Rebels or the dramatic weight of Andor, but it knows what it wants to say and stays on course. Plus, veteran fans will find plenty of rewarding nods and **** a masterpiece, but it leaves a good impression and subtly expands Star Wars’ grayer corners. For those curious about life beyond the Republic and the Empire, these tales are a worthy detour.
